Albino Ferrets While albinos aren’t linked to Waardenburg syndrome, they do tend to have a

small hearing mechanism

in their inner ear. Albinos are often hard of hearing, but they are rarely deaf , unlike

dark-eyed whites

.

Rarest Ferret: What is the rarest ferret

Sable is the most common and cinnamon is the most rare , but ferrets come in a myriad of color patterns. There are eight basic ferret colors: Albino, Black, Black Sable, Champagne, Chocolate, Cinnamon, Dark-Eyed White and Sable.

Panda Ferret: What is a panda ferret

Much like a panda bear, a panda patterned ferret has a contrasting head and

body color darker colors

are found around the hips and shoulders and mitts are present on the feet and sometimes the tail. Occasionally panda ferrets also have small color rings around their eyes.

White Ferrets: Do all white ferrets have red eyes

White ferrets tend to have darker colored eyes, and their coat may feature slightly yellow highlights that can be seen in the sunlight. Albino ferrets have no color anywhere on their bodies, and their eyes are always red The red eyes are a sure sign of albino coloring because other ferrets do not have red eyes.

Silver Ferrets Deaf: Are silver ferrets deaf

Silver ferrets had a 4% deafness rate Mitt ferrets (white paws) without other white markings had a 31% were deaf. Mitt ferrets with other white marking had a 2% incidence of deafness.
